The Maintenance Technician will be responsible for routine and preventative property maintenance, including equipment repairs, as well as ensuring the safety of residents and any guests according to company standards and compliant with all federal, state and local laws
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
- Communicate all unusual issues/problems or discoveries on and in the property and its surroundings to Supervisor
- Bring suggestions and ideas you may have to contribute to the team and property in a positive way
- Performs maintenance and repair work on the interior and exterior of building, kitchen/refrigeration equipment, lighting, heating/air conditioning (HVAC) ventilation, water treatment systems and swimming pools
- Timely completion of make readies with attention to detail and quality of work
- Perform apartment inspections for preventative maintenance needs
- Maintains a clean and safe shop, and store supplies and materials when delivered in a safe and organized manner
- Completes work orders, repairs, and maintains cleanliness in a timely manner while maintaining safety in all property areas, including the interior and exterior of buildings
- Utilize excellent communication skills while regularly interacting with residents, vendors, contractors, all levels of employees, and clients
- Provide snow removal service such as spreading ice melt or with shovels when necessary
- Troubleshoot areas of HVAC, electrical, plumbing, carpentry, appliance repair and seek advice when needed
